package integration
|
|
|
|
import (
|
|
"fmt"
|
|
"net/http"
|
|
"testing"
|
|
)
|
|
|
|
func TestStickerCreateExpressionsPermission(t *testing.T) {
|
|
client := newTestClient(t)
|
|
owner := createTestAccount(t, client)
|
|
memberWithCreate := createTestAccount(t, client)
|
|
memberWithManage := createTestAccount(t, client)
|
|
memberWithNeither := createTestAccount(t, client)
|
|
|
|
ensureSessionStarted(t, client, owner.Token)
|
|
ensureSessionStarted(t, client, memberWithCreate.Token)
|
|
ensureSessionStarted(t, client, memberWithManage.Token)
|
|
ensureSessionStarted(t, client, memberWithNeither.Token)
|
|
|
|
guild := createGuild(t, client, owner.Token, "Sticker Expressions Guild")
|
|
guildID := parseSnowflake(t, guild.ID)
|
|
channelID := parseSnowflake(t, guild.SystemChannel)
|
|
|
|
invite := createChannelInvite(t, client, owner.Token, channelID)
|
|
for _, member := range []testAccount{memberWithCreate, memberWithManage, memberWithNeither} {
|
|
resp, err := client.postJSONWithAuth(fmt.Sprintf("/invites/%s", invite.Code), nil, member.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to accept invite: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
resp.Body.Close()
|
|
}
|
|
|
|
// Permission bits
|
|
const manageExpressions = 1 << 30
|
|
|
|
defaultWithoutCreate := 137439396353
|
|
|
|
defaultWithManageInsteadOfCreate := defaultWithoutCreate | manageExpressions
|
|
|
|
// Create roles for each member
|
|
var roleForCreate, roleForManage, roleForNeither struct {
|
|
ID string `json:"id"`
|
|
}
|
|
|
|
resp, err := client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/roles", guildID), map[string]any{
|
|
"name": "Creator",
|
|
},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
decodeJSONResponse(t, resp, &roleForCreate)
|
|
|
|
resp, err = client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/roles", guildID), map[string]any{
|
|
"name": "Manager",
|
|
"permissions": fmt.Sprintf("%d", defaultWithManageInsteadOfCreate),
|
|
},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
decodeJSONResponse(t, resp, &roleForManage)
|
|
|
|
resp, err = client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/roles", guildID), map[string]any{
|
|
"name": "NoExpressions",
|
|
"permissions": fmt.Sprintf("%d", defaultWithoutCreate),
|
|
},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
decodeJSONResponse(t, resp, &roleForNeither)
|
|
|
|
resp, err = client.patchJSONWithAuth(fmt.Sprintf("/guilds/%d/roles/%d", guildID, guildID), map[string]any{
|
|
"permissions": fmt.Sprintf("%d", defaultWithoutCreate),
|
|
},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to update @everyone role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
resp.Body.Close()
|
|
|
|
memberWithCreateID := parseSnowflake(t, memberWithCreate.UserID)
|
|
memberWithManageID := parseSnowflake(t, memberWithManage.UserID)
|
|
memberWithNeitherID := parseSnowflake(t, memberWithNeither.UserID)
|
|
|
|
resp, err = client.requestJSON(http.MethodPut, fmt.Sprintf("/guilds/%d/members/%d/roles/%s", guildID, memberWithCreateID, roleForCreate.ID), nil,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to assign role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usNoContent)
|
|
resp.Body.Close()
|
|
|
|
resp, err = client.requestJSON(http.MethodPut, fmt.Sprintf("/guilds/%d/members/%d/roles/%s", guildID, memberWithManageID, roleForManage.ID), nil,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to assign role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usNoContent)
|
|
resp.Body.Close()
|
|
|
|
resp, err = client.requestJSON(http.MethodPut, fmt.Sprintf("/guilds/%d/members/%d/roles/%s", guildID, memberWithNeitherID, roleForNeither.ID), nil,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to assign role: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usNoContent)
|
|
resp.Body.Close()
|
|
|
|
stickerImage := "data:image/png;base64," + getValidPNGBase64()
|
|
|
|
t.Run("member with CREATE_EXPRESSIONS can create sticker", func(t *testing.T) {
|
|
resp, err := client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ers", guildID), map[string]any{
|
|
"name": "creatorsticker",
|
|
"description": "A test sticker",
|
|
"tags": []string{"test"},
|
|
"image": stickerImage,
|
|
}, mem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("member without CREATE_EXPRESSIONS cannot create sticker", func(t *testing.T) {
|
|
resp, err := client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ers", guildID), map[string]any{
|
|
"name": "nopermssticker",
|
|
"description": "A test sticker",
|
|
"tags": []string{"test"},
|
|
"image": stickerImage,
|
|
}, memberWithNeither.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to make request: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usForbidden)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
// Create sticker by memberWithCreate to test edit/delete permissions
|
|
var creatorSticker struct {
|
|
ID string `json:"id"`
|
|
}
|
|
resp, err = client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ers", guildID), map[string]any{
|
|
"name": "mysticker",
|
|
"description": "My sticker",
|
|
"tags": []string{"mine"},
|
|
"image": stickerImage,
|
|
}, mem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
decodeJSONResponse(t, resp, &creatorSticker)
|
|
|
|
// Create sticker by owner to test cross-user permissions
|
|
var ownerSticker struct {
|
|
ID string `json:"id"`
|
|
}
|
|
resp, err = client.postJ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ers", guildID), map[string]any{
|
|
"name": "ownersticker",
|
|
"description": "Owner sticker",
|
|
"tags": []string{"owner"},
|
|
"image": stickerImage,
|
|
}, owner.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to create s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
decodeJSONResponse(t, resp, &ownerSticker)
|
|
|
|
t.Run("creator can update their own sticker with CREATE_EXPRESSIONS", func(t *testing.T) {
|
|
resp, err := client.patchJ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, creatorSticker.ID), map[string]any{
|
|
"name": "myupdatedsticker",
|
|
"description": "Updated description",
|
|
"tags": []string{"updated"},
|
|
}, mem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to update s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("creator cannot update another user's sticker with only CREATE_EXPRESSIONS", func(t *testing.T) {
|
|
resp, err := client.patchJ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, ownerSticker.ID), map[string]any{
|
|
"name": "hackedsticker",
|
|
"description": "Hacked description",
|
|
"tags": []string{"hacked"},
|
|
}, mem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to make request: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usForbidden)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("member with MANAGE_EXPRESSIONS can update another user's sticker", func(t *testing.T) {
|
|
resp, err := client.patchJSONWithAuth(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, ownerSticker.ID), map[string]any{
|
|
"name": "managedupdated",
|
|
"description": "Managed update",
|
|
"tags": []string{"managed"},
|
|
}, memberWithManage.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to update s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usOK)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("creator cannot delete another user's sticker with only CREATE_EXPRESSIONS", func(t *testing.T) {
|
|
resp, err := client.delete(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, ownerSticker.ID), mem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to make request: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usForbidden)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("member with MANAGE_EXPRESSIONS can delete another user's sticker", func(t *testing.T) {
|
|
resp, err := client.delete(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, ownerSticker.ID), memberWithManage.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to delete s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usNoContent)
|
|
resp.Body.Close()
|
|
})
|
|
|
|
t.Run("creator can delete their own sticker with CREATE_EXPRESSIONS", func(t *testing.T) {
|
|
resp, err := client.delete(fmt.Sprintf("/guilds/%d/stickers/%s", guildID, creatorSticker.ID), memberWithCreate.Token)
|
|
if err != nil {
|
|
t.Fatalf("failed to delete sticker: %v", err)
|
|
}
|
|
assertStatus(t, resp, http.StatusNoContent)
|
|
resp.Body.Close()
|
|
})
|
|
}
